What Usually Requires A Permit In A Bathroom Remodel

As a rule, painting, swapping a vanity, or changing hardware is usually permit-free, while work that changes systems behind the walls often brings Baldwin County building permit requirements for bathroom remodel into play.

A simple fixture swap is one thing. A shower relocation, a new exhaust fan, or a recessed niche cut into framing is another.

If the remodel involves more than replacing like with like, it is worth checking before work starts, not after.

Accessibility upgrades can be straightforward, but they still intersect with structural and plumbing details that inspectors may want to see.

How To Keep Permit Costs And Delays Under Control

The best way to manage permit cost is to plan the scope carefully before anyone starts tearing out tile.

If you are comparing contractors, ask who handles the permit application, who pays the fee upfront, and whether the estimate includes inspection coordination.
